How they compare
Ghana currently reports 0.6723 against 0.6685 in Senegal, a difference of 0.0038.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 13 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Ghana ahead.
Ghana ranks 112th and Senegal ranks 114th of 147 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Ghana averaged higher in 2 and Senegal in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ghana | Senegal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.6704 | 0.6427 | 0.0277 | Ghana |
| 2010s | 0.6863 | 0.6774 | 0.0088 | Ghana |
| 2020s | 0.6704 | 0.6788 | 0.0084 | Senegal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
